CD Fleet Services says new mobile functionality is best in market

Andy Brown, managing director of CD Fleet Services, said: “The new website (www.cdauctiongroup.com) is fully responsive and has been specifically designed to display vendor stock equally clearly across desktop, tablet and smartphone.

“It means our fleet vendors will get better exposure to trade buyers who will now be able to view, select and bid, anytime, anywhere. Our smartphone and tablet functionality is particularly strong and, we believe, the best in the market.”

The new website also features new graphics to make navigation more intuitive; a search function to find specific cars by make and mileage; and a ‘my auction’ function so that buyers can pre-select vehicles that catch their eye from the stock of vehicles available.

The company added that despite the fresh new look and responsive functionality, it has not changed the robust and genuine online bidding platform, which enables approved buyers to place bids at any time of the day or night with the ‘robobid’ system automatically bidding up to a maximum amount entered and keeping the buyer informed of the sale progress.

“Buyers don’t have to sit around waiting for a vehicle they’re interested in to come ‘on sale’; all the lots are available for bidding up until the auction closes,” explained Brown.

“This is a significant difference between our genuine online auction and the pseudo-online systems that are simply web-feeds of a physical sale.”

The launch of the new website forms part of a major investment in the CD Auction Group business to meet increased demand, which has also seen the company recently increase its storage capacity to handle more vehicles and appoint a new business development coordinator.
